Description
A quick and easy summer side dish featuring sweet corn wrapped in thick-cut bacon and grilled, then slathered with a tangy, spicy chili lime butter. Perfect for last-minute gatherings.
Ingredients
Scale
- 6–8 ears of fresh sweet corn, husked and silk removed
- 12–16 strips thick-cut bacon
- 1/2 cup (113g) unsalted butter, softened
- 3–4 tablespoons fresh lime juice (from 2 limes)
- 1 teaspoon chili powder
- 1/2 teaspoon cumin
- 1 clove garlic, minced
- Salt and black pepper to taste
- Optional garnish: Crumbled cotija cheese, fresh cilantro, lime wedges
Instructions
- Shuck the corn, removing husks and silk. Rinse under cold water and pat dry.
- In a small bowl, mix softened butter, lime juice, chili powder, cumin, minced garlic, salt, and pepper until smooth. Taste and adjust seasoning.
- Wrap two strips of bacon around each ear of corn, spiraling from top to bottom. Secure with toothpicks if necessary.
- Optional: Soak wrapped corn in water for 15-20 minutes to prevent drying out.
- Preheat grill to medium-high heat (375-400°F).
- Place corn on the grill and cook for 20-25 minutes, turning every 5-7 minutes, until bacon is crispy and corn is tender.
- Remove from grill and immediately slather generously with the chili lime butter.
- Serve hot with optional toppings like cotija cheese and cilantro.
Notes
Soaking the corn helps keep it juicy and prevents the bacon from burning too quickly. Use thick-cut bacon for better texture. If the bacon browns too fast, move corn to a cooler part of the grill. Leftover chili lime butter can be stored in the fridge for up to 1 week or frozen in ice cube trays.
